Where is Aussie conditioner made?

Products produced under this brand are mainly hair care products like shampoos, hair serums, gels, sprays and conditioners. The brand contains certain natural ingredients from Australia. The logo of the brand is a kangaroo, which is native to Australia. Procter & Gamble in America manufacture the brand.

Who owns Aussie hair products?

Procter & Gamble
However, the brand is in fact manufactured by Procter & Gamble, an American company, which bought the brand in 2003. Aussie manufactures hair product collections for straight, wavy, and curly hair to fix problems such as frizz, dryness, flat hair, and damaged hair.
